Situated in a remote region of Western Zambia is the little-visited, vast, open grasslands and woodland of the Liuwa Plain. This immense wilderness with massive skies is simply brimming with wildlife – unusual birdlife such as pink-throated longclaws, sooty chats, black-winged pratincoles and wattled cranes mixes with the huge numbers of pelicans, spoonbills, egrets, bustards and secretary birds.

By early June, once the rains have passed through, you can see many antelope species that are rare elsewhere – such as roan, red lechwe, steinbuck, oribi and duiker – plus eland and buffalo. The predators here are significant too and include large packs of wild dog, cheetah, hyena and, thanks to a successful reintroduction programme – lions are now making a comeback.

    Here the pattern continues - early morning and late afternoon game drives or wildlife walks, and ample time to relax back in camp during the heat of the day. Game drives are in comfortable open 4-wheel drive vehicles accompanied by a qualified guide. Night drives offer the unforgettable experience of exploring the bush with a spotlight to see nocturnal species such as genet, mongoose or little duiker. On walking safaris you will learn about tracking, gain an insight into the life of small mammals and insects that cannot be seen on a game drive, or experience the thrill of getting close to a herd of elephant on foot. A qualified guide and armed game scout accompany all walks.
